First, fit the rubber sealing strip around the edge before attaching the heater to the underside of the board. Overlap both ends to provide a better seal.
Rear of the motherboard with prepared heater element.
When connecting the heater element and inserting the screws, make sure current delivery is in the direction of the PCI contacts.
